Analyzing New Unique Identifier Formats (UUIDv6, UUIDv7, and UUIDv8) (2022)
The spec as written on that page is confusing on that point, but the incrementing-counter-within-the-same-millisecond-behavior only happens if you explicitly specify a "monotonicFactory", https://github.com/ulid/javascript#monotonic-ulids. The default behavior (just using the ulid() function) doesn't do that, it generates a completely random value regardless of the millisecond value.
